Premises Liability Consultant
On-site · Texas, United States or Aurora, Colorado, United States
Job Summary
Premises Liability Consultant focused on delivering clear, defensible analysis of building conditions impacting safety and liability. Responsibilities include conducting code compliance reviews for ADA/local/state/federal regulations, performing forensic investigations of incident sites (stairs, ramps, walkways, lighting, surfaces), reconstructing accidents with field measurements/photos/3D modeling, evaluating standard of care for design professionals, contractors, and property owners, and reviewing construction documents, contracts, and maintenance records to identify defects or negligence. Eligible candidate will hold a bachelor’s degree in Architecture or Engineering (or related field), 5+ years of relevant forensic/construction-expertise, an active GC/PE/AIA license, and demonstrated business development and client relationship skills. Benefits include health/dental/vision, FSA, and ESOP; eligible for Blueprint Helpers referral program.
Required Qualifications
- Bachelor’s degree in Architecture, Engineering, or related field
- 5+ years of experience in forensic consulting, building inspections, or code compliance analysis
- Active GC, PE, or AIA license
- Proven business development experience, including client relationship management and project acquisition
